Synonyme

Palaeoniscus (Rhadinichthys) modulus Dawson, 1877

Status

Nach Moy-Thomas (1938) und Gardiner (1966) ein Synonym zu †Rhadinichthys alberti. Gardiner stellte fest, dass †Canobius modulus ein "eigenartig erhaltenes Exemplar" von †Rhadinichthys alberti ist.


Typen

Holotypus: Redpath Museum, McGill University. (Dort nicht gefunden).
